jimmy has a pool sixteen feet wide and twelve feet long how much material does he need to cover the pool

Respuesta :

sophcatdevils
sophcatdevils sophcatdevils
  • 11-09-2020

Answer:

192 square feet of material

Step-by-step explanation:

You find the area of the pool, which is length x width, and that is 12 x 16, which is equal to 192
